## Build Provenance: Hermetic Migration

Welcome aboard. The Quellstone pipeline is moving from ad-hoc shell builds to the hermetic Lanternforge system. Every input — toolchains, sources, vendored deps — must now be declared explicitly; nothing may leak in from the host. Before merging, confirm your target rebuilds bit-identically on two isolated runners. The provenance record for the reference build is below.

session token of fahap-hawip = htk31_7852f2b3276dba2738f98fa97f92237

09:41 — Alert fired on Lanternworth loyalty ledger: point balances drifting negative for roughly 300 members. 09:48 — On-call paused the accrual consumer to stop further writes. 09:56 — Identified duplicate redemption events replayed after the Kestrel queue failover; ledger applied them twice. 10:10 — Replay guard patched, consumer resumed, corrections job queued for affected accounts. 10:32 — Balances reconciled and alert cleared. The duplicate events originated from a single consumer build, noted below.

pipeline stamp: htk31_f769b577b3028a4e9958e5bb8d1259a

Q3 Planning — Project Lanternwell Delay

Lanternwell slips one quarter. Integration testing failed twice; revised go-live is now January. Sales leads: do not promise Lanternwell features in renewals before then. Pipeline forecasts should revert to current tooling assumptions. Weekly status resumes Monday. The confidential note below outlines how this delay affects our broader commercial plans.

board note of tawig-bajof: The renewal with Ralixix Holdings closes at $10 million a year, 20 percent above the last contract. Project Druix slips by two quarters because of the tooling delay.

## Config Hot-Reload Approvals

Bramblefox services reload configuration on SIGHUP without restart. On-call engineers may trigger a reload for threshold and logging changes; anything touching routing tables or credentials paths requires prior approval. Reloads are logged to the audit channel automatically. If a reload hangs, roll back the config file first, then escalate. Approval authority for hot-reloads rests with one person.

named custodian: Brivan Eliath Quenox Frador